Extracellular matrix stiffness primes the NLRP-inflammasome by promoting NLRP3 gene expression via FAK/mTOR/nuclear-actin/SREBP signalling in vascular smooth muscle cells

Arterial stiffening is associated with an increased risk of cardiovascular disease (CVD) morbidity and mortality. We investigated the effects of ECM-stiffness on the expression of NLRP3, a component of the NLRP3-inflammasome. VSMC interacting with a stiff (50 ... ...
